Welcome to the Department of Information Technology site at the City of Berkeley, CA.
The Department of Information Technology provides leadership in the development of powerful, cost-effective technical services and business solutions for City staff and policy makers. Furthermore, the Department empowers Berkeley's citizens by serving as an accessible, comprehensive, integrated information resource for the City and its Government.
IT Digital Strategic Plan & Roadmap - The IT Digital Strategic Plan & Roadmap (DSP Roadmap) is the result of a comprehensive and thorough assessment of the City's existing technologies, operational requirements and service delivery needs. The documents reflect a business and technology strategy that is technologically strategic, operationally responsive, and fiscally responsible.
